Day 1: Arrival in Tangier » Visit the Monuments of the City » Chefchaouen (Blue City)
Upon arrival in Tangier, your 6 Days Desert Tour From Tangier begins with a guided visit to the city’s main monuments and landmarks. You will explore highlights such as the Kasbah, the old Medina, and scenic viewpoints overlooking the meeting point of the Atlantic Ocean and the Mediterranean Sea. Tangier’s unique mix of African, European, and Arab influences offers a perfect introduction to Morocco.
After exploring the city, the journey continues inland toward the Rif Mountains. Along the way, you will enjoy changing landscapes and panoramic views as you leave the coast behind. The drive itself is part of the experience, offering glimpses of traditional villages and lush mountain scenery.
In the afternoon, you arrive in Chefchaouen, famously known as the Blue City. You will have free time to wander through its blue painted streets, take photos, and soak in the relaxed atmosphere. The day ends with an overnight stay in Chefchaouen, surrounded by the calm beauty of the Rif Mountains.
Day 2: Chefchaouen » Roman Ruins in Volubilis » Meknes » Fes
After breakfast in Chefchaouen, the journey continues south toward the ancient Roman ruins of Volubilis, one of the best preserved archaeological sites in Morocco. Here, you will explore impressive mosaics, columns, and ruins that reflect the region’s Roman history, set against a scenic countryside backdrop.
Next, you travel to Meknes, one of Morocco’s imperial cities. During your visit, you will discover key landmarks such as Bab Mansour, the old medina, and historic royal structures that showcase the city’s imperial past. Meknes offers a quieter and more authentic atmosphere compared to other major cities.
In the afternoon, you continue to Fes, the cultural and spiritual heart of Morocco. Upon arrival, you check into your accommodation and enjoy a relaxed evening, preparing for a deeper exploration of the city on the following day.
Day 3: Fes » Ifrane » Azrou » Midelt » Merzouga Desert
Departing from Fes, the route leads south through the Middle Atlas Mountains, passing through Ifrane, often called the Switzerland of Morocco for its alpine-style architecture and clean streets. The journey continues to Azrou, where cedar forests are home to the famous Barbary macaques, offering a chance to stop and enjoy the natural surroundings.
The drive continues through mountain landscapes and open plains toward Midelt, a town known for its apple farms and mountain views, located between the Middle Atlas and High Atlas ranges. Along the way, you will experience dramatic changes in scenery as green forests give way to arid terrain.
By late afternoon, you arrive in the Merzouga Desert, at the edge of the Sahara. Here, the adventure truly begins with a camel trek across the golden dunes of Erg Chebbi, leading to your desert camp. The day ends with a traditional dinner, music around the campfire, and a night under the stars in the heart of the desert.
Day 4: Merzouga Desert » Rissani » Erfoud » Todra Gorges » Dades Valley
Leaving the Merzouga Desert behind, the journey continues toward Rissani, a historic town known as the gateway to the Sahara and an important former trading center. You will pass through traditional markets and palm filled landscapes that reflect the region’s deep desert roots.
The route then leads to Erfoud, famous for its fossils and date palms, before heading west through changing desert scenery. As the landscape becomes more dramatic, towering cliffs begin to appear, signaling your arrival at the impressive Todra Gorges, where sheer rock walls rise high above a narrow riverbed.
After time to explore and walk through the gorges, the drive continues to the scenic Dades Valley. Known for its winding roads, red rock formations, and lush oases, the valley offers stunning views. The day concludes with an overnight stay in the Dades Valley, surrounded by dramatic mountain landscapes.
Day 5: Dades Valley » Rose Valley » Ouarzazate » Ait Ben Haddou » Marrakech
The journey continues through the scenic landscapes of the Dades Valley, heading toward the fragrant Rose Valley, known for its rose fields and local cooperatives producing rose based products. This region offers a glimpse into traditional rural life set against colorful valleys and kasbahs.
Next, you arrive in Ouarzazate, often called the gateway to the Sahara and famous for its film studios and historic kasbahs. The route then leads to the UNESCO World Heritage Site of Ait Ben Haddou, an iconic fortified village made of clay and earth, widely recognized for its unique architecture and cinematic history.
In the afternoon, the drive continues across the High Atlas Mountains via the Tizi n’Tichka pass, offering panoramic views and mountain scenery. By evening, you arrive in Marrakech, where the day ends with an overnight stay in the vibrant Red City.

Know Before You Go:
- This 6 Days Desert Tour From Tangier involves long driving distances, so a flexible schedule and comfortable clothing are recommended. Morocco’s climate varies by region, with cooler temperatures in the mountains and warmer conditions in the desert, especially during summer months. Bringing layers is advised to stay comfortable throughout the journey.
- Comfortable walking shoes are essential, as many stops include exploring medinas, kasbahs, and natural sites on foot. For the desert experience, sunglasses, sunscreen, and a scarf or hat are useful to protect against sun and sand. Evenings in the Sahara can be cool, particularly in winter.
- Cash is recommended for lunches, tips, souvenirs, and small local purchases, as card payments are not always accepted in rural areas. Always carry your passport with you, follow local customs, and respect photography rules, especially when taking photos of people or in religious areas.
